Rain is a regular occurrence at Walt Disney World Resort. We'll call it part of the Flordia charm. A little light rain should not affect parades, but heavier showers will. But Hakuna Matata! You may just be able to see the Rainy Day Cavalcade. This super unique offering is so much fun and is sure to leave a smile on your face. Stage shows such as
Mickey's Magical Friendship Faire may not occur during rain.
When it comes to meeting Mickey Mouse rain traditionally only interferes with
Character Greetings that take place outside in the theme parks. The majority of
Mickey's favorite spots to greet Guests are inside, meaning he is excited to sign autographs rain or shine.
Character Dining experiences are indoors, and are only impacted by park closure for severe weather. So if you are heading to
Chef Mickey's to have dinner with the whole gang, thunderstorms will not impact your adventure.
Speaking of severe weather, if your question happens to be referring to all of Walt Disney World Resort, the answer is yes on occasion. Should
extreme weather conditions head towards the magic, Walt Disney World Resort may choose to temporarily close theme parks, water parks, and Disney Springs for the safety of their Guests and Cast Members. Checking in at Walt Disney World Resort Collection hotels may also be limited. There are
special cancelation policies in place for this type of weather event.
